高中生学编程用什么书

fiy 其他 3

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    高中生学习编程时可以使用以下几本书:

    1. 《Python编程从入门到实践》:Python是一门简单易学的编程语言,适合初学者入门。这本书从基础语法到实际项目开发都有详细的介绍和实例,适合高中生快速入门。

    2. 《算法图解》:学习编程不仅要学习语法,还要了解算法和数据结构。这本书通过图解的方式介绍了常见的算法和数据结构,适合高中生培养编程思维和解决问题的能力。

    3. 《Java核心技术》:如果你想学习面向对象编程语言,Java是一个不错的选择。这本书详细介绍了Java语言的核心概念和特性,适合高中生系统学习Java。

    4. 《HTML与CSS设计与构建网站》:如果你对前端开发有兴趣,学习HTML和CSS是必不可少的。这本书通过实例介绍了HTML和CSS的基础知识和常用技巧,适合高中生学习前端开发。

    5. 《计算机科学导论》:这本书介绍了计算机科学的基本概念和原理,包括计算机硬件、操作系统、网络等方面的知识。对于高中生了解计算机科学的整体框架和发展历程有很大帮助。

    此外,除了纸质书籍,还可以通过在线教育平台、编程网站等途径学习编程。比如,Codecademy、Coursera、edX等网站提供了丰富的编程课程和项目实践,适合高中生进行自主学习和实践。同时,参加编程社区、论坛或者加入学校的编程社团也是提高编程能力的有效途径。总之,学习编程需要不断实践和积累,通过多种途径获取知识和经验,不断提高自己的编程能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    高中生学习编程可以使用以下几本书:

    1.《Python编程快速上手:让繁琐工作自动化》:Python是一门易学易用的编程语言,适合初学者入门。这本书以Python为例,介绍了基本的编程概念和语法,并通过实际案例帮助读者快速掌握编程技巧。

    2.《Java核心技术》:Java是一门广泛应用于企业开发和移动应用开发的编程语言。这本书详细介绍了Java的基本概念、语法和常用库函数,适合有一定编程基础的高中生深入学习。

    3.《C++ Primer》:C++是一门面向对象的编程语言,广泛应用于游戏开发和系统编程等领域。这本书系统地介绍了C++的语法和常用技巧,对于有一定编程基础的高中生来说是一本很好的学习资料。

    4.《算法导论》:算法是编程中非常重要的一部分,它涉及到如何解决问题和提高程序效率。这本书介绍了常用的算法和数据结构,对于高中生进一步提升编程能力和解决实际问题非常有帮助。

    5.《HTML与CSS设计与构建网站》:学习网页开发是很多高中生入门编程的第一步。这本书详细介绍了HTML和CSS的基本知识和技巧,帮助读者掌握网页设计和构建的基本原理。

    这些书籍都是经典的编程学习资料,对于高中生学习编程非常有帮助。除了书籍之外,还可以参加一些编程培训班或者在线教育平台,通过实践项目来提高编程能力。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    作为高中生学习编程,选择适合自己的编程书籍是非常重要的。以下是一些适合高中生学习编程的书籍推荐:

    1.《Python编程快速上手——让繁琐工作自动化》
    这本书以Python作为教学语言,适合初学者入门。书中介绍了Python的基础知识,包括变量、数据类型、控制流程等,并通过实例来帮助读者解决实际问题。

    2.《Java编程思想》
    这本书是学习Java编程的经典教材之一。它详细介绍了Java语言的基础知识和面向对象编程的概念,并通过大量实例来帮助读者理解和掌握Java编程。

    3.《C++ Primer Plus》
    这本书适合有一定编程基础的高中生学习C++。它从C++的基础语法开始介绍,包括变量、控制流程、函数等,然后深入讲解了面向对象编程、模板、异常处理等内容。

    4.《算法导论》
    这本书是学习算法和数据结构的经典教材之一。它详细介绍了常用的算法和数据结构,并通过伪代码和实例来帮助读者理解和实现这些算法。

    5.《Web前端开发技术与实践》
    对于对前端开发感兴趣的高中生,这本书是一个很好的选择。它介绍了HTML、CSS、JavaScript等前端技术的基础知识,并通过实例来帮助读者学习和实践前端开发。

    在选择编程书籍时,建议根据自己的兴趣和需求来选择适合自己的书籍。除了纸质书籍,还可以考虑在线教程、视频教程等其他学习资源,多种形式的学习可以帮助提高学习效果。另外,参加编程培训班或者加入编程社群也是一个很好的学习方式,可以与其他编程爱好者交流学习经验。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部